So I just spent an age creating a pdf with editable text fields.

Whenever I select a field with text in it, the text moves! It drops down by about 2 millimeters and then pops back into position when I click away from it. However, if I enter *new* text in the field it stays in the shifted position, resulting in a doc with text all out of line. Is this a setting I can turn off?

When I look at the bounding boxes of the text field, they haven't moved, it is only the text inside the boxes that is shifting.

correct answers 1 Correct answer

Community Expert , Jul 20, 2022 Jul 20, 2022

This is because there are some line returns at the end of the text.

Removing them solves the problem.

Yes I did, through pure trial and error. In the text box properties, under Options, make sure the Allow Rich Text Formatting option is selected. Doing this seemed to slightly adjust the text within the fields, so the text always stays in the starting position. Also, as the other users have stated, make sure there are no blank returns at the end of the text box. Hope that helps!
